Helvellyn
Helvellyn is a mountain in the Lake District, Cumbria, England. It has a summit elevation of 950 metres (3,117 feet) above sea level, making it the third-highest peak in England and the highest point in the Eastern Fells. The mountain lies within the Lake District National Park.
